OPRF Boys Soccer Faces Proviso East in Regional Opener

No. 6 Huskies open post-season play against Proviso East in Darien at 6:30 p.m.

The Oak Park and River Forest High School boys soccer kicks off post-season play at 6:30 p.m. Tuesday, facing Proviso East at Hinsdale Central High School in Darien. 

The Huskies (9-5-5), seeded No. 6 in the Class 3A playoffs, are the favorite going into the tournament against Proviso, seeded at No. 11.

OPRF ended their season with last Thursday, with a tie against Nazareth Academy. 

The winner of the 6:30 match on Oct. 22 will play the winner of the 4:30 match between No. 7 Hinsdale South and No. 3 Benet Academy on Friday, Oct. 25.
